Real cedar asks for attention; polymer shake does not. Molded from actual shakes, quality synthetic lines carry Class 4 hail ratings and strong fire ratings without treatment, and never need the cleaning-and-treatment cycle wood demands in a DFW climate. The trade is character: cedar ages into individuality, polymer stays uniform.
